A Comprehensive Guide to Garage Door Opener Motor Replacement

When your garage door starts making unusual noises, moving sluggishly, or fails to operate altogether, it often points to a failing motor in the garage door opener. A garage door opener motor replacement is a common yet critical task for homeowners looking to restore functionality and security to their garage. This comprehensive guide will walk you through everything you need to know about this process, from identifying the need for a replacement to the steps involved in completing the project successfully.

The garage door opener motor is the heart of the entire system, responsible for converting electrical energy into mechanical motion to lift and lower the heavy door. Over years of service, these motors can wear out due to factors like frequent use, power surges, lack of maintenance, or simple old age. Recognizing the signs of a failing motor early can prevent further damage to other components and avoid the safety risks associated with a malfunctioning garage door.

Common indicators that a garage door opener motor replacement might be necessary include:

  • The door does not respond to any commands from the remote or wall switch, though the lights might still turn on.
  • You hear a humming sound from the motor unit, but the door does not move, suggesting the motor is trying to run but lacks the power.
  • The motor feels excessively hot to the touch after a short period of operation, indicating it is overworking or has internal electrical issues.
  • There is a burning smell emanating from the motor unit, a serious sign of electrical failure that requires immediate attention.
  • The garage door operates intermittently, working sometimes and failing at others, which can point to a dying motor.

Before proceeding with a full garage door opener motor replacement, it is wise to perform some basic troubleshooting to confirm the motor is indeed the problem. Check the power source first; ensure the opener is plugged in and that the circuit breaker hasn’t tripped. Inspect the remote control batteries and the safety sensors to make sure they are clean and properly aligned. Sometimes, the issue might be with the drive mechanism or springs, not the motor itself. If all these elements are functional, the motor is likely the culprit.

Once you have decided that a replacement is necessary, the next step is to choose the right motor for your garage door opener. Garage door opener motors are not universal; they are designed to be compatible with specific brands and models. The most important factors to consider are:

  1. Motor Power and Horsepower (HP): The power of the motor must match the weight and size of your garage door. Common ratings include 1/2 HP for single doors, 3/4 HP for heavier single or double doors, and 1 HP for very large or insulated double doors.
  2. Drive Type: Garage door openers use chain drive, belt drive, or screw drive systems. The motor must be compatible with your existing drive type. Belt drive motors are quieter, chain drives are more durable for heavy doors, and screw drives are low-maintenance.
  3. Brand and Model Compatibility: It is often easiest and most cost-effective to purchase a replacement motor from the same manufacturer as your existing opener. Check the model number of your opener to find a compatible motor.
  4. New Features: While replacing the motor, you might consider upgrading to a model with newer features like battery backup, smart connectivity (Wi-Fi), or a more powerful gear system for smoother operation.

After selecting the appropriate replacement motor, the actual process of garage door opener motor replacement can begin. This is a project that requires careful attention to safety, as you will be working with electrical components and a heavy, tensioned system. If you are not comfortable with electrical work or handling the high-tension springs of a garage door, it is highly recommended to hire a professional. However, for those with DIY experience, here is a general step-by-step guide.

The first and most critical step is to disconnect the power to the garage door opener. Unplug the unit from the electrical outlet or turn off the circuit breaker that supplies power to it. This prevents any risk of electric shock during the replacement process. Next, if your garage door opener has a backup battery, remove it as well. To relieve tension from the system, disconnect the garage door from the opener by pulling the release cord or lever. This allows you to operate the door manually.

With the power off and the door disconnected, you can now remove the old motor. The motor is typically housed within the main unit of the opener, which is mounted on the ceiling of the garage. You may need an assistant to help support the unit while you work. Using a ladder, secure the opener unit with locking pliers or have your assistant hold it. Then, disconnect the wiring that connects the motor to the rest of the opener. Take a picture of the wiring configuration before disconnecting anything; this will be invaluable when installing the new motor. Unscrew the mounting brackets or bolts that hold the motor assembly in place and carefully lower it.

Now, install the new garage door opener motor. Position the new motor in place, securing it with the mounting brackets and bolts. Reconnect the wiring exactly as it was on the old motor, referring to the photo you took earlier. Most replacement motors come with a wiring diagram; double-check your connections against this diagram to ensure they are correct. Once the motor is securely mounted and wired, you can reconnect the garage door to the opener mechanism. Restore power to the unit by plugging it in or turning the circuit breaker back on.

After completing the garage door opener motor replacement, testing is crucial. Use the wall switch or remote to operate the door. Observe the movement; it should be smooth and quiet. Listen for any unusual noises from the new motor. Test the auto-reverse safety feature by placing an object, like a block of wood, in the path of the closing door. The door should stop and reverse upon contact. Finally, reprogram any remotes or keypads to the new motor unit if necessary, following the manufacturer’s instructions.
